Drain Line Replacement Cost Range in Bradenton, FL
Typical costs for drain line replacement in Bradenton, FL, can vary depending on project specifics. The following provides a general overview of the expected price ranges for different project types.
$1,500 - $4,000: Basic residential drain line replacement involving accessible underground piping.
$4,000 - $8,000: More extensive replacements including additional excavation or replacement of multiple drain lines.
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Standard residential drain line replacement | $1,500 - $4,000 |
| Commercial drain line replacement | $4,500 - $12,000 |
| Emergency or urgent replacement | $2,000 - $6,000 |
| Replacement with trenchless technology | $3,000 - $8,000 |
| Line rerouting or reretrofit | $2,500 - $7,000 |
| Partial line replacement | $1,500 - $3,500 |
| Complete system overhaul | $8,000 - $20,000 |
What affects the cost of Drain Line Replacement
Understanding the factors that influence drain line replacement costs can help homeowners in Bradenton, FL, make informed decisions. Several elements can impact the overall expense of a project, including the scope of work and local requirements.
- Materials used: The choice of piping materials, such as PVC or cast iron, can affect material costs and durability.
- Size and scope: Longer or more complex drain lines, including those with multiple connections, typically increase costs.
- Labor complexity: Difficult access, such as working beneath slabs or in tight spaces, can require additional effort and increase labor expenses.
- Permitting requirements: Local regulations in Bradenton may necessitate permits, inspections, and related fees that influence overall costs.
- Additional services or extras: Items like trench restoration, pipe lining, or dealing with unforeseen issues can add to the project expenses.
